Position Overview

Director, Corporate FP&A is a senior leadership role responsible for end‑to‑end long‑range planning (LRP) and enterprise‑level financial strategy. This role serves as a strategic partner to Finance leadership, Strategy, and executive stakeholders, integrating inputs across the company to deliver clear, decision‑ready insights.

The Director leads the enterprise business case process, provides outside‑in benchmarking and strategic perspective, and supports forward‑looking materials for executive leadership and the Board of Directors. This role requires strong leadership, sound judgment, executive presence, and the ability to influence peers across Finance, Strategy, and Operations.

Responsibilities
  • Own Autodesk’s end‑to‑end long‑range planning (LRP), including assumptions, scenarios, pressure‑testing, executive storytelling, and calendar orchestration

  • Establish enterprise LRP timelines, milestones, and dependencies to ensure alignment across Finance, Strategy, Treasury, and business units

  • Integrate financial and strategic inputs across Finance, Strategy, Treasury, and business units into a cohesive enterprise view

  • Lead the enterprise business case process, partnering with Finance, Strategy, and cross‑functional leaders to inform investment decisions

  • Develop and review confidential financial models and analyses for strategic initiatives

  • Provide peer benchmarking and outside‑in market perspective to inform long‑term planning and decision‑making

  • Orchestrate Board of Directors materials related to long‑range outlooks and forward‑looking scenarios

  • Deliver ad hoc analyses and special projects for senior Finance and executive leadership

  • Lead and develop a multi‑layered team, setting strategic direction and priorities across long‑range planning, modeling, benchmarking, and executive requests

  • Ensure rigor, continuity, and risk management across high‑visibility, high‑impact financial work streams

Minimum Qualifications
  • 12+ years of progressive experience in FP&A, Corporate Finance, Strategy, or related roles

  • Experience in technology, SaaS, or subscription‑based business models

  • Proven experience owning or leading long‑range planning or enterprise‑level financial planning processes

  • Skilled at working across multiple levels, including high level strategy and insights thinking to disciplined processes leadership of complex planning cycles

  • Strong financial modeling, analytical, and problem‑solving skills

  • Experience in finance support of M&A deals

  • Excellent communication, presentation and facilitation skills with a proven ability to work collaboratively and influence across all levels of leadership

  • Strong people leader with proven experience managing teams in complex, matrixed environments and a demonstrated track record of building and elevating high performing teams

  •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, Economics, or a related field; MBA or advanced degree in Finance, Business, or a related field preferred

  • Background in management consulting, investment banking, or equity research preferred
